Barwon River entrance – sand movement and safety update

Published on 12 March 2026

 


Further to Notice to Mariners 146-2026, we wanted to share more information around the Barwon River bar.

Barwon Coast is working closely with the Department of Transport and Planning and Safe Transport Victoria to manage the current sandbar conditions. Based on historic hydrographic survey records held by Barwon Coast, the entrance channel alignment has remained largely consistent since 1984, and all navigational aids are positioned in accordance with the most recent surveys.

Prolonged south east wind and swell conditions over the last 6-12 months have moved sand into the river mouth. Combined with limited downstream flows from the Barwon River, this has led to the build-up of sand currently affecting depths at the bar.

In the meantime, temporary buoys will be installed to help guide vessels through the river entrance. These will be an interim measure while we continue to monitor how the river system adjusts. The buoys are expected to be implemented following the results of the latest hydrographic survey and will depend on contractor availability and weather conditions – we’re working to have them in place as soon as possible. Please note that no dredging works are planned now or in the future.

Navigational aids currently mark safe water approximately 1.5 hours either side of high tide during daylight hours, and only in conditions of low swell and light winds. Mariners are strongly advised to remain within the marked channel due to reef outcrops and other hazards.

We appreciate everyone’s patience while these changes are managed. Most importantly, we want everyone heading out on the water to make informed decisions and return home safely.
